Metus is a privately owned company headquartered in the US. Founded in 2004, the company has an estimated 40 employees. It specializes in software development, offering file-based management, transcoding, video capture, and play solutions. These solutions cater to various sectors, including Broadcast Television Stations, House of Worship, Military, Entertainment, Post Production, Medical, Government, Corporate, and Education.

Previously, on January 20, 2026, Metus announced a strategic collaboration with Lenovo, showcased at Integrated Systems Europe (ISE) 2026 in Barcelona from February 3-6. During the event, Metus demonstrated its media workflow solutions live on Lenovo workstations at the Lenovo booth.
